@randynix980511 ай бұрын
I'll agree with you except for moving the plate down. By doing that you are messing with the spring tension for the governor. If you do mess with moving the plate, be sure to adjust the governor back to location. before running the engine. Which really defeats your reason for moving the plate. Those two screws holding the plate have thread locker on them so that they don't vibrate and move. and to deter people from moving the plate. Adjust the idle with the idle screw, that is what is it's. there for.
@tntautowerkz180911 ай бұрын
The plate also has the slots in it for the adjustment! That's why there is elongated slots there! and that's how the Repair/Service manual says to do it! Thanks for watching!
@scottp24627 ай бұрын
Gotta agree with TnT on the plate adjustment. The service manual does state to adjust the max RPM by adjusting the plate after the throttle cable is properly adjusted as TnT states. Where I found a difference with this video and my own CV15S engine is the plate moving up decreases rpm and moving it downward increases rpm. This is because more or less tension is applied to the governor spring.
